Legitimate origins from which software can be obtained?

Explanation:
Software should come from trusted channels where the publisher’s license and authenticity are verified. The best answer is that software comes from software sources, which covers official vendor sites, authorized distributors, and app stores—the places you’re assured you’re getting a legitimate, supported product. The other ideas don’t fit as the origin. Product keys and serial numbers are for activating software, not where it originates. AI isn’t a source for legitimate software delivery. OEM websites can provide certain software tied to hardware, but that’s a narrow and not universal source.
